当前位置: 代码网 > 服务器>服务器>Linux > Linux清理服务器磁盘空间的方法

Linux清理服务器磁盘空间的方法

2026年04月21日 Linux 我要评论
简介当服务器的磁盘空间,尤其是系统盘,被跑满时,系统指令都是没法用的就像 windows 的 c 盘被占满一样,什么操作都做不了,只能等系统一点一点腾出空间最近博主清理了几台服务器的磁盘空间,这里记录

简介

当服务器的磁盘空间,尤其是系统盘,被跑满时,系统指令都是没法用的

就像 windows 的 c 盘被占满一样,什么操作都做不了,只能等系统一点一点腾出空间

最近博主清理了几台服务器的磁盘空间,这里记录一下清理服务磁盘的流程

先分析

敲下面的命令,先分析一下服务器的磁盘状态,看挂载了几块硬盘,挂到哪个目录下的

# 查看磁盘挂载情况
df -h

# 查看磁盘情况
fdisk -l

如下,我就一块 80g 的硬盘,挂载了根目录下

找文件

可以敲下面的命令,看根目录下的目录占用磁盘空间的情况

du -sh /* 2>/dev/null | sort -hr

如下,找前面几个大的目录,找出一下大文件夹,再一层一层找,看哪些文件大,可以挪走(挪到其他挂载点)或删掉

清理日志

除此之外,可以清理一下系统产生的日志记录,敲下面的命令,查看一下日志记录占用的磁盘空间

journalctl --disk-usage

我这台服务器只有 8.0m,不清理也罢

如果占用很大,可以敲下面的命令,只保留最近 1 天的数据

journalctl --vacuum-time=1d

执行完会告诉你腾出了多少磁盘空间

到此这篇关于linux清理服务器磁盘空间的方法的文章就介绍到这了,更多相关linux清理服务器磁盘空间内容请搜索代码网以前的文章或继续浏览下面的相关文章希望大家以后多多支持代码网!

(0)

相关文章:

版权声明:本文内容由互联网用户贡献,该文观点仅代表作者本人。本站仅提供信息存储服务,不拥有所有权,不承担相关法律责任。 如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 2386932994@qq.com 举报,一经查实将立刻删除。

发表评论

验证码:
Copyright © 2017-2026  代码网 保留所有权利. 粤ICP备2024248653号
站长QQ:2386932994 | 联系邮箱:2386932994@qq.com